Fix python executed during configure
Previously it relied on AX_PYTHON_DEVEL, which in turn executes
python-config to get the build flags. However this does not work while
cross compiling because we can't execute the python-config build for the
target platform. To circumvent this problem the python build flags are
now queried via pkgconfig, which has the drawback of not having some
extra build flags, but they do not seem to be needed.

I tested this patch with the termux build system and it build without
their existing hack of injecting python after the configure step. I also
tested non cross compile build on Arch Linux and it also still works.

Fixes #851

# Process this file with autoconf to produce a configure script.
AC_PREREQ([2.69])
AC_INIT([profanity],[0.12.0],[jubalh@iodoru.org],[profanity],[https://profanity-im.github.io/])
AC_CONFIG_AUX_DIR([build-aux])
AC_CONFIG_MACRO_DIR([m4])
AC_CONFIG_SRCDIR([src/main.c])
AC_CONFIG_HEADERS([src/config.h])
AM_INIT_AUTOMAKE([foreign subdir-objects])
AC_PROG_CC
LT_INIT
AC_SYS_LARGEFILE
## Determine platform
AC_CANONICAL_TARGET
PLATFORM="unknown"
AS_CASE([$target_os],
[freebsd*], [PLATFORM="freebsd"],
[netbsd*], [PLATFORM="netbsd"],
[openbsd*], [PLATFORM="openbsd"],
[darwin*], [PLATFORM="osx"],
[cygwin], [PLATFORM="cygwin"],
[PLATFORM="nix"])
PACKAGE_STATUS="development"
## Get git branch and revision if in development
if test "x$PACKAGE_STATUS" = xdevelopment; then
AM_CONDITIONAL([INCLUDE_GIT_VERSION], [true])
AC_DEFINE([HAVE_GIT_VERSION], [1], [Include git info])
else
AM_CONDITIONAL([INCLUDE_GIT_VERSION], [false])
fi
AC_DEFINE_UNQUOTED([PACKAGE_STATUS], ["$PACKAGE_STATUS"], [Status of this build])
AS_IF([test "x$PLATFORM" = xcygwin],
[AC_DEFINE([PLATFORM_CYGWIN], [1], [Cygwin])])
AS_IF([test "x$PLATFORM" = xosx],
[AC_DEFINE([PLATFORM_OSX], [1], [OSx])])
## Environment variables
AC_ARG_VAR([PYTHON_FRAMEWORK], [Set base directory for Python Framework])
## Options
AC_ARG_ENABLE([notifications],
[AS_HELP_STRING([--enable-notifications], [enable desktop notifications])])
AC_ARG_ENABLE([python-plugins],
[AS_HELP_STRING([--enable-python-plugins], [enable Python plugins])])
AC_ARG_ENABLE([c-plugins],
[AS_HELP_STRING([--enable-c-plugins], [enable C plugins])])
AC_ARG_ENABLE([plugins],
[AS_HELP_STRING([--enable-plugins], [enable plugins])])
AC_ARG_ENABLE([otr],
[AS_HELP_STRING([--enable-otr], [enable otr encryption])])
AC_ARG_ENABLE([pgp],
[AS_HELP_STRING([--enable-pgp], [enable pgp])])
AC_ARG_ENABLE([omemo],
[AS_HELP_STRING([--enable-omemo], [enable OMEMO encryption])])
AC_ARG_WITH([xscreensaver],
[AS_HELP_STRING([--with-xscreensaver], [use libXScrnSaver to determine idle time])])
AC_ARG_WITH([themes],
[AS_HELP_STRING([--with-themes[[=PATH]]], [install themes (default yes)])])
AC_ARG_ENABLE([icons-and-clipboard],
[AS_HELP_STRING([--enable-icons-and-clipboard], [enable GTK tray icons and clipboard paste support])])
# Required dependencies
AC_CHECK_FUNCS([atexit memset strdup strstr])
PKG_CHECK_MODULES([glib], [glib-2.0 >= 2.62.0], [],
[AC_MSG_ERROR([glib 2.62.0 or higher is required])])
PKG_CHECK_MODULES([gio], [gio-2.0], [],
[AC_MSG_ERROR([libgio-2.0 from glib-2.0 is required])])
AC_SEARCH_LIBS([fmod], [m], [],
[AC_MSG_ERROR([math.h is required])], [])
PKG_CHECK_MODULES([curl], [libcurl >= 7.62.0], [],
[AC_CHECK_LIB([curl], [main], [],
[AC_MSG_ERROR([libcurl 7.62.0 or higher is required])])])
PKG_CHECK_MODULES([SQLITE], [sqlite3 >= 3.22.0], [],
[AC_MSG_ERROR([sqlite3 3.22.0 or higher is required])])
ACX_PTHREAD([], [AC_MSG_ERROR([pthread is required])])
AS_IF([test "x$PTHREAD_CC" != x], [ CC="$PTHREAD_CC" ])
### plugins
## python
if test "x$enable_plugins" = xno; then
AM_CONDITIONAL([BUILD_PYTHON_API], [false])
elif test "x$enable_python_plugins" != xno; then
AS_IF([test "x$PLATFORM" = xosx], [
AS_IF([test "x$PYTHON_FRAMEWORK" = x], [ PYTHON_FRAMEWORK="/Library/Frameworks/Python.framework" ])
AC_MSG_NOTICE([Symlinking Python.framework to $PYTHON_FRAMEWORK])
rm -f Python.framework
ln -s $PYTHON_FRAMEWORK Python.framework ])
PKG_CHECK_MODULES([python], [python-embed], [PYTHON_CONFIG_EXISTS=yes], [PYTHON_CONFIG_EXISTS=no])
PKG_CHECK_MODULES([python], [python3-embed], [PYTHON3_CONFIG_EXISTS=yes; AC_DEFINE(PY_IS_PYTHON3, [1], [Is Python version 3])], [PYTHON3_CONFIG_EXISTS=no])
if test "$PYTHON_CONFIG_EXISTS" = "yes" || test "$PYTHON3_CONFIG_EXISTS" = "yes"; then
AM_CONDITIONAL([BUILD_PYTHON_API], [true])
AC_DEFINE([HAVE_PYTHON], [1], [Python support])
else
if test "x$enable_python_plugins" = xyes; then
AC_MSG_ERROR([Python not found, cannot enable Python plugins.])
else
AM_CONDITIONAL([BUILD_PYTHON_API], [false])
AC_MSG_NOTICE([Python development package not found, Python plugin support disabled.])
fi
fi
AS_IF([test "x$PLATFORM" = xosx], [rm -f Python.framework])
# set path to look for global python plugins
GLOBAL_PYTHON_PLUGINS_PATH='${pkgdatadir}/plugins'
AC_SUBST(GLOBAL_PYTHON_PLUGINS_PATH)
else
AM_CONDITIONAL([BUILD_PYTHON_API], [false])
fi
## C
if test "x$PLATFORM" = xcygwin; then
AM_CONDITIONAL([BUILD_C_API], [false])
else
LT_INIT
if test "x$enable_plugins" = xno; then
AM_CONDITIONAL([BUILD_C_API], [false])
elif test "x$enable_c_plugins" != xno; then
# libdl doesn't exist as a separate library in the BSDs and is
# provided in the standard libraries.
AS_IF([test "x$PLATFORM" = xopenbsd -o "x$PLATFORM" = xfreebsd -o "x$PLATFORM" = xnetbsd],
[AM_CONDITIONAL([BUILD_C_API], [true]) AC_DEFINE([HAVE_C], [1], [C support])],
[AC_CHECK_LIB([dl], [main],
[AM_CONDITIONAL([BUILD_C_API], [true]) LIBS="$LIBS -ldl" AC_DEFINE([HAVE_C], [1], [C support])],
[AS_IF(
[test "x$enable_c_plugins" = xyes],
[AC_MSG_ERROR([dl library needed to run C plugins])],
[AM_CONDITIONAL([BUILD_C_API], [false])])
])])
# set path to look for global c plugins
GLOBAL_C_PLUGINS_PATH='${pkglibdir}/plugins'
AC_SUBST(GLOBAL_C_PLUGINS_PATH)
else
AM_CONDITIONAL([BUILD_C_API], [false])
fi
fi
## Check for libstrophe
PKG_CHECK_MODULES([libstrophe], [libstrophe >= 0.11.0],
[LIBS="$libstrophe_LIBS $LIBS" CFLAGS="$CFLAGS $libstrophe_CFLAGS"])
AC_MSG_CHECKING([whether libstrophe works])
AC_LINK_IFELSE([AC_LANG_SOURCE([[
#include <strophe.h>
int main() {
xmpp_initialize();
return 0;
}
]])],
[AC_MSG_RESULT([yes])],
[AC_MSG_ERROR([libstrophe is broken, check config.log for details])])
## Check for curses library
PKG_CHECK_MODULES([ncursesw], [ncursesw],
[NCURSES_CFLAGS="$ncursesw_CFLAGS"; NCURSES_LIBS="$ncursesw_LIBS"; CURSES="ncursesw"],
[PKG_CHECK_MODULES([ncurses], [ncurses],
[NCURSES_CFLAGS="$ncurses_CFLAGS"; NCURSES_LIBS="$ncurses_LIBS"; CURSES="ncurses"],
[AC_CHECK_LIB([ncursesw], [main], [],
[AC_CHECK_LIB([ncurses], [main], [],
[AC_CHECK_LIB([curses], [main],
[LIBS="$LIBS -lcurses"; CURSES="curses"],
[AC_MSG_ERROR([ncurses or curses is required for profanity])])])])])])
AM_CFLAGS="$AM_CFLAGS $NCURSES_CFLAGS"
LIBS="$NCURSES_LIBS $LIBS"
## Check wide characters support in curses library
CFLAGS_RESTORE="$CFLAGS"
CFLAGS="$CFLAGS $NCURSES_CFLAGS"
AC_CACHE_CHECK([for wget_wch support in $CURSES], ncurses_cv_wget_wch,
[AC_LINK_IFELSE([AC_LANG_SOURCE([
void wget_wch(void);
int main() {
wget_wch();
return 0;
}
])],
[ncurses_cv_wget_wch=yes],
[ncurses_cv_wget_wch=no])
])
CFLAGS="$CFLAGS_RESTORE"
AS_IF([test "x$ncurses_cv_wget_wch" != xyes],
[AC_MSG_ERROR([ncurses does not support wide characters])])
## Check for ncursesw/ncurses.h first, Arch linux uses ncurses.h for ncursesw
AC_CHECK_HEADERS([ncursesw/ncurses.h], [], [])
AC_CHECK_HEADERS([ncurses.h], [], [])
AC_CHECK_HEADERS([curses.h], [], [])
# Check for readline
AS_IF([test "x$PLATFORM" = xosx],
[AC_PATH_PROG([BREW], [brew], ["failed"],
[$PATH:/opt/homebrew/bin:/usr/local/bin])
AS_IF([test "x$BREW" = xfailed],
[AC_CHECK_FILE([/opt/local/lib/libreadline.dylib],
[READLINE_PREFIX="/opt/local"],
[READLINE_PREFIX="/usr/local"])],
[READLINE_PREFIX="`$BREW --prefix readline`"])])
AS_IF([test "x$PLATFORM" = xosx],
[AC_CHECK_FILE([$READLINE_PREFIX/lib/libreadline.dylib],
[LIBS="-lreadline $LIBS"
AM_CPPFLAGS="-I$READLINE_PREFIX/include $AM_CPPFLAGS"
AM_LDFLAGS="-L$READLINE_PREFIX/lib $AM_LDFLAGS"
AC_SUBST(AM_LDFLAGS)],
[AC_MSG_ERROR([libreadline is required for profanity. Install it with Homebrew, MacPorts, or manually into /usr/local])])],
[test "x$PLATFORM" = xopenbsd],
[AC_CHECK_FILE([/usr/local/include/ereadline],
[LIBS="-lereadline $LIBS"
AM_CFLAGS="-I/usr/local/include/ereadline $AM_CFLAGS"
AM_LDFLAGS="-L/usr/local/lib $AM_LDFLAGS"
AC_SUBST(AM_LDFLAGS)])],
[AC_CHECK_LIB([readline], [main], [],
[AC_MSG_ERROR([libreadline is required for profanity])])])
## Check for optional dependencies depending on feature flags
dnl feature: icons-and-clipboard
AS_IF([test "x$enable_icons_and_clipboard" != xno],
[PKG_CHECK_MODULES([GTK], [gtk+-3.0 >= 3.24.0],
[AC_DEFINE([HAVE_GTK], [1], [libgtk module])],
[AS_IF([test "x$enable_icons_and_clipboard" = xyes],
[PKG_CHECK_MODULES([GTK], [gtk+-2.0 >= 2.24.10],
[AC_DEFINE([HAVE_GTK], [1], [libgtk module])],
[AC_MSG_ERROR([gtk+-2.0 >= 2.24.10 or gtk+-3.0 >= 3.24.0 is required for icons and clipboard])],
[AC_MSG_NOTICE([gtk+-3.0/gtk+2.0 not found, icons and clipboard not enabled])])])])])
ICONS_PATH='${pkgdatadir}/icons'
AC_SUBST(ICONS_PATH)
dnl feature: notifications
## Check for desktop notification support
## Linux/FreeBSD require libnotify
## Windows uses native OS calls
## OSX requires terminal-notifier
AS_IF([test "x$PLATFORM" = xosx],
[AS_IF([test "x$enable_notifications" != xno],
[NOTIFIER_PATH="no"
AC_PATH_PROG(NOTIFIER_PATH, terminal-notifier, no)
AS_IF([test "x$NOTIFIER_PATH" = xno],
[AS_IF([test "x$enable_notifications" = xyes],
[AC_MSG_ERROR([terminal-notifier not found, required for desktop notifications.])],
[AC_MSG_NOTICE([Desktop notifications not supported.])])],
[AC_DEFINE([HAVE_OSXNOTIFY], [1], [terminal notifier])])])],
[test "x$PLATFORM" = xnix -o "x$PLATFORM" = xfreebsd],
[AS_IF([test "x$enable_notifications" != xno],
[PKG_CHECK_MODULES([libnotify], [libnotify],
[AC_DEFINE([HAVE_LIBNOTIFY], [1], [libnotify module])],
[AS_IF([test "x$enable_notifications" = xyes],
[AC_MSG_ERROR([libnotify is required but does not exist])],
[AC_MSG_NOTICE([libnotify support will be disabled])])])])])
dnl feature: xscreensaver
AS_IF([test "x$enable_xscreensaver" != xno],
[PKG_CHECK_MODULES([xscrnsaver], [xscrnsaver],
[AC_MSG_NOTICE([xscreensaver support is enabled])],
[AS_IF([test "x$enable_xscreensaver" = xyes],
[AC_MSG_ERROR([xscreensaver is required but does not exist])],
[AC_MSG_NOTICE([xscreensaver support is disabled])])])])
dnl feature: pgp
AM_CONDITIONAL([BUILD_PGP], [false])
if test "x$enable_pgp" != xno; then
AC_CHECK_LIB([gpgme], [main],
[AM_CONDITIONAL([BUILD_PGP], [true])
AC_DEFINE([HAVE_LIBGPGME], [1], [Have libgpgme])
AC_PATH_PROG([GPGME_CONFIG], [gpgme-config], ["failed"])
AS_IF([test "x$GPGME_CONFIG" = xfailed],
[LIBS="-lgpgme $LIBS"],
[LIBS="`$GPGME_CONFIG --libs` $LIBS" AM_CFLAGS="`$GPGME_CONFIG --cflags` $AM_CFLAGS"])],
[AS_IF([test "x$enable_pgp" = xyes],
[AC_MSG_ERROR([libgpgme is required for pgp support])],
[AC_MSG_NOTICE([libgpgme not found, pgp support not enabled])])])
fi
dnl feature: otr
AM_CONDITIONAL([BUILD_OTR], [false])
if test "x$enable_otr" != xno; then
AM_CONDITIONAL([BUILD_OTR], [true])
PKG_CHECK_MODULES([libotr], [libotr >= 4.0],
[LIBS="$libotr_LIBS $LIBS" CFLAGS="$libotr_CFLAGS $cflags"],
[AM_CONDITIONAL([BUILD_OTR], [false])
AS_IF([test "x$enable_otr" = xyes],
[AC_MSG_ERROR([libotr >= 4.0 is required for OTR support])],
[AC_MSG_NOTICE([libotr >= 4.0 not found, OTR support not enabled])])])
AM_COND_IF([BUILD_OTR], [AC_DEFINE([HAVE_LIBOTR], [1], [Have libotr])])
fi
dnl feature: omemo
AM_CONDITIONAL([BUILD_OMEMO], [false])
if test "x$enable_omemo" != xno; then
AM_CONDITIONAL([BUILD_OMEMO], [true])
PKG_CHECK_MODULES([libsignal], [libsignal-protocol-c >= 2.3.2],
[LIBS="-lsignal-protocol-c $LIBS"],
[AC_MSG_NOTICE([libsignal-protocol-c >= 2.3.2 not found, OMEMO support not enabled])])
AC_CHECK_LIB([gcrypt], [gcry_md_extract],
[LIBS="-lgcrypt $LIBS"],
[AM_CONDITIONAL([BUILD_OMEMO], [false])
AS_IF([test "x$enable_omemo" = xyes],
[AC_MSG_ERROR([gcrypt >= 1.7.0 is required for OMEMO support])],
[AC_MSG_NOTICE([gcrypt >= 1.7.0 not found, OMEMO support not enabled])])])
AM_COND_IF([BUILD_OMEMO], [AC_DEFINE([HAVE_OMEMO], [1], [Have OMEMO])])
fi
dnl feature: themes
AS_IF([test "x$with_themes" = xno],
[THEMES_INSTALL="false"],
[THEMES_INSTALL="true"])
AS_IF([test "x$with_themes" = xno -o "x$with_themes" = xyes -o "x$with_themes" = x],
[THEMES_PATH='${pkgdatadir}/themes'],
[THEMES_PATH="$with_themes"])
AC_SUBST(THEMES_PATH)
AM_CONDITIONAL([THEMES_INSTALL], "$THEMES_INSTALL")
